Hi All,

I am new to Oracle APEX and even to the BIRT reports. Can anyone help me how to integrate the Birt reports in the Orace APEX. We are not interested to use IFrames. Is it possible to show the Birt Viewer without IFrames.

I have not worked with APEX but the BIRT viewer has three main servlet
mappings. frameset, run, and preview. Take a look at this page for more
detail.
http://www.eclipse.org/birt/phoenix/deploy/viewerUsageMain.p hp#servlets

You can also use the tag libraries and deploy using a div instead of an
iframe.
http://www.eclipse.org/birt/phoenix/deploy/viewerUsageMain.p hp#tags
